What I Noticed About the Vormax Flushing System

The biggest reason I paid attention to the Vormax toilets was the flushing performance. In my experience, a toilet can look great on paper, but the real test is how well it clears the bowl. Vormax is designed with dual nozzles that help create a stronger flush and cleaner rinse. That stood out to me because I wanted a toilet that didn’t leave me worrying about repeated flushes or stubborn residue.

Installation Factors I Considered

I always think about installation before choosing a toilet. Even a great toilet can become frustrating if it’s difficult to install or requires extra parts. I looked at whether the Vormax model used a standard rough-in size and whether the installation instructions seemed straightforward. If you’re like me and want a smoother setup, it helps to check the product details carefully before buying.

What I Recommend Checking Before You Buy

Before I choose a Vormax toilet, I always check:

  • Rough-in size
  • Bowl height and comfort level
  • One-piece or two-piece design
  • Flush performance features
  • Customer reviews at Lowe’s
  • Warranty details
  • Available delivery or installation support
